浏览器打不开json文件?别担心!几种轻松打开JSON文件的方法
当你双击一个.json文件,期待浏览器直接展示清晰的数据结构时,却可能遇到文件直接下载、显示为纯文本乱码,或者干脆提示“无法打开”的情况,别慌!这其实是JSON文件的“特性”导致的——它本质上是纯文本数据文件,不像HTML那样能直接被浏览器渲染成页面,下面我们就来聊聊,为什么浏览器会“拒绝”打开JSON文件,以及几种简单有效的打开方法。
为什么浏览器直接打开JSON文件会“翻车”?
首先得明白:JSON(JavaScript Object Notation)本质上是一种轻量级的数据交换格式,它的核心作用是“存储和传输数据”,而不是“展示内容”,浏览器默认会尝试将文件解析为HTML页面,而.json文件里没有HTML标签(如<html>、<body>),也没有CSS样式或JavaScript交互逻辑,所以浏览器不知道如何“渲染”它,只能采取两种默认处理方式:
- 直接下载:部分浏览器(如Chrome、Edge)会认为.json是“需要下载的文件”,而不是需要显示的页面;
- 显示纯文本:如果浏览器尝试显示,也会因为数据结构复杂(如嵌套对象、数组)而呈现一大堆无格式的文本,看起来像“乱码”,难以阅读。
3种简单方法,轻松打开JSON文件
既然浏览器直接打开“不给力”,我们就换种思路——要么借助工具“美化”显示,要么用代码“解析”展示,以下是3种最常用的方法,小白也能轻松操作。
方法1:用代码编辑器打开(推荐新手首选)
代码编辑器是处理JSON文件的“利器”,不仅能打开文件,还能自动格式化数据、高亮显示语法,让你一眼看清数据结构。
推荐工具:
- VS Code(免费、轻量,支持Windows/Mac/Linux)
- Sublime Text(简洁快速,适合小文件)
- Notepad++(Windows系统专用,支持语法高亮)
操作步骤(以VS Code为例):
- 右键点击.json文件,选择“Open with VS Code”(或用VS Code菜单栏“文件→打开”选择文件);
- 打开后,VS Code会自动识别JSON格式,用不同颜色区分键(key)、值(value)、字符串、数字等(比如键是橙色,字符串是绿色);
- 如果数据是“压缩版”(没有换行和缩进),按
Shift+Alt+F(Windows)或Shift+Option+F(Mac),VS Code会自动格式化,瞬间变成清晰的结构。
优点:无需安装额外插件,打开即用,还能直接编辑和保存。
方法2:用浏览器插件“美化”显示(适合需要预览的场景)
如果你习惯用浏览器查看,又不想切换到代码编辑器,可以安装“JSON美化”插件,让浏览器把JSON文件展示成“可折叠的树形结构”,阅读体验直接拉满。
推荐插件:
- JSON Viewer Pro(Chrome、Edge均支持,免费,支持折叠/展开节点、搜索关键词)
- JSON Viewer(Firefox插件,轻量无广告)
操作步骤(以Chrome为例):
- 在Chrome应用商店搜索“JSON Viewer Pro”,点击“添加到Chrome”;
- 安装后,直接双击.json文件,浏览器会自动用插件打开(如果没自动打开,右键文件选择“用JSON Viewer Pro打开”);
- 插件界面左侧是“树形结构”,可以点击/-折叠/嵌套层级;右侧是“原始文本”,方便对照查看;还能顶部的搜索框快速定位特定字段。
优点:保留浏览器环境,适合临时预览、快速查找数据,无需切换软件。
方法3:用在线JSON解析工具(适合不想安装软件的情况)
如果你不方便安装代码编辑器或浏览器插件(比如在公共电脑上),可以用在线工具直接上传并解析JSON文件。
推荐工具:
- JSON Formatter & Validator(https://jsonformatter.curiousconcept.com/)
- BeautifyJSON(https://beautifyjson.com/)
操作步骤:
- 打开在线工具页面,通常会有一个“拖拽文件到此处”或“点击选择文件”的按钮;
- 上传.json文件后,工具会自动格式化数据,显示成带缩进、高亮的树形结构;
- 部分工具还支持“验证JSON格式”(检查文件是否写错,比如漏了逗号、引号),如果格式错误会提示具体位置。
注意:如果文件包含敏感数据(如个人信息、API密钥),不建议使用在线工具,避免数据泄露。
特殊情况:浏览器下载了JSON文件怎么办?
有时候双击.json文件,浏览器直接弹出了下载窗口,文件没显示而是保存到了本地,这可能是浏览器的“下载行为偏好”导致的,解决方法很简单:
- Chrome/Edge:打开设置 → 隐私和安全 → 网站设置 → 下载内容,将“下载前询问每个文件下载位置”开启,之后打开.json文件时,会弹出提示“打开”或“保存”,选“打开”即可;
- Firefox:设置 → 通用 → 下载历史,勾选“询问每个文件的保存位置”,同样能触发“打开/保存”选项。
遇到JSON文件打不开,记住这3步
- 首选代码编辑器(如VS Code):自动格式化+语法高亮,适合日常查看和编辑;
- 次选浏览器插件(如JSON Viewer Pro):保留浏览器环境,适合临时预览和快速搜索;
- 急用在线工具:适合公共电脑,但注意数据安全,避免上传敏感信息。
其实JSON文件“打不开”不是问题,只是需要找对“工具钥匙”,下次再遇到.json文件,别急着点“下载”,试试以上方法,你会发现它比想象中更“易读”!



还没有评论,来说两句吧...